The cost of hill removal in Paducah, KY, can vary significantly based on several factors. Whether you're looking to clear land for construction, landscaping, or other purposes, understanding the elements that influence the cost can help you budget more effectively.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Size of the Hill: Larger hills require more resources and time to remove, increasing the overall cost.
  • Soil Composition: Harder, rocky soil is more challenging to remove than softer, sandy soil.
  • Accessibility: If the hill is in a hard-to-reach area, specialized equipment may be needed, raising costs.
  • Environmental Regulations: Compliance with local environmental laws can add to the expense.
  • Disposal of Debris: Transporting and disposing of the removed soil and rocks can be costly.
  • Labor Costs: The cost of labor in Paducah, KY, can vary, impacting the total price.
  • Equipment Needed: Specialized machinery like bulldozers or excavators can add to the expense.

Average Costs for Common Tasks

Task Average Cost in Paducah, KY
Small Hill Removal (up to 2 feet) $1,500 - $3,000
Medium Hill Removal (2-5 feet) $3,000 - $7,000
Large Hill Removal (5+ feet) $7,000 - $15,000
Soil Testing and Analysis $300 - $600
Debris Disposal $200 - $500 per load
Equipment Rental $500 - $1,200 per day
Labor Costs $50 - $100 per hour
